Get to know this occupation

Description

This professional oversees the design and calculation of aeronautic elements able to bear the strain to which they will be subjected in optimum safety conditions and that respond to the requirements of the project, at a technical and economic level (generation of economies of scale, manufacturing costs and maintenance...). In this post, the expert concentrates on both interna and external structures for example, passenger areas or ailerons and undercarriages. The engineering design determines the materials that must be used to build and mount each piece or section according to its characteristics and behaviour via different calculation methodologies and support models. This will allow virtual designs in 3D to be produced (generated by the designer in the case of passenger areas) and the creation of prototypes using ALIAS modellers.

Tasks

  • Carry out the three-dimensional structural design with the assistance of a software tool, eg, CATIA. Starting from the initial design, carry out different tests to ensure that the project is correctly developed.
  • Study structure loads (ailerons, undercarriage, etc.) and laws of operation of the various materials taking into account different operation hypothesis.
  • Rehearse different possibilities and pose new technical possibilities considering the various size options and materials (metals, composites, etc.). In each case, determin the critical load.
  • Choose the final design taking into account functionality, the cost, the fulfillment of requirements and the manufacturing process.
  • Produce the results report and description of the structure, and deliver it to the customer.
